Can my lungs heal from vaping?

Yes, your lungs can begin to heal from vaping as soons as you quit, with inflammation decreasing and lung function improving over weeks to months, but recovery depends on the damage's severity, with some scarring being permanent; quitting immediately offers the best chance for significant healing and reducing risks for chronic conditions like COPD.

How long does it take for your lungs to recover from vaping?

So, the sooner you quit vaping, the more significant your healing will be. Research indicates that lung function starts to improve two or three weeks after quitting. However, symptoms like coughing and breathing difficulties can remain for a year or longer as the lungs continue to repair damage where they can.

Is damage from vaping reversible?

While many people see substantial lung recovery, heavy or prolonged vaping can sometimes cause lung damage that may not be fully reversible. That's why quitting vaping as early as possible is so important for maximising your lung healing and reducing the risk of long-term breathing issues.

What are the early symptoms of popcorn lung?

What are the signs and symptoms of popcorn lung?

  • Coughing, especially during and after exercise. Coughs may sometimes bring up mucus.
  • Shortness of breath (dyspnea), especially during and after exercise.
  • Wheezing.
  • Tiredness.
  • Fever.
  • Night sweats.
  • Skin rash.

What do 2 years of vaping do to your lungs?

Vaping has been linked to greater risk of chronic lung diseases like asthma or chronic bronchitis, as well as heart problems including heart failure, and continuing to vape after an EVALI diagnosis may cause permanent scarring in your lungs. Vaping may also lower some measures of lung function over time.

Can black lungs turn pink again?

Lungs that have turned black due to smoking or pollution may not fully return to their original pink state. However, quitting smoking and avoiding pollutants can improve lung function and health over time. The body can heal to some extent, but complete reversal of discoloration is unlikely.

How many hits of a vape is equal to 1 cig?

There's no exact number, but roughly 10-15 vape puffs can equal one cigarette, though this varies greatly; it could be as few as 4 puffs with high-nicotine liquid or up to 50 puffs with weaker liquid, depending on puff duration, device power (pod vs. mod), and e-liquid strength (like 5% vs. 12mg/mL). A single cigarette delivers about 1-2 mg of nicotine, while a vape's nicotine delivery changes significantly with user style and device settings.

How do doctors detect popcorn lungs?

To diagnose popcorn lung, a doctor will: ask about your health history, including if you use e-cigarettes to vape. listen to your breathing with a stethoscope. order tests such as a chest x-ray or CT scan.

How do you fix lung damage from vaping?

“There's isn't a good treatment for lipoid pneumonia, other than supportive care, while the lungs heal on their own,” says Broderick. “The single-most important thing you can do is identify what is causing it — in this case vaping — and eliminate it.”

What are signs lungs are healing?

Healing Cilia: Tiny hair-like structures in your lungs (cilia) begin to recover, helping your body clear out mucus, bacteria, and other harmful substances. Easier Breathing: As your lungs clear out built-up mucus, you'll notice it's easier to breathe deeply, and coughing becomes less frequent.

Why do I feel worse 3 months after quitting smoking?

Neurotransmitters like dopamine (the feel-good chemical) drop suddenly, and your brain must learn to produce them naturally again. This adjustment can take weeks or even months. So, while you may be free from the physical addiction, the emotional and mental side of quitting continues to play out.

How do doctors check for lung damage?

Chest X-rays can detect cancer, infection or air collecting in the space around a lung, which can cause the lung to collapse. They can also show ongoing lung conditions, such as emphysema or cystic fibrosis, as well as complications related to these conditions.
